Former Pakistan Test cricketer and renowned ECB Level 4 coach Atiq-uz-Zaman joins Saj for an exclusive interview on PakPassion. He shares his honest insights into Pakistan cricket's challenges, strategies, and missed opportunities. He discusses the disastrous Champions Trophy campaign, the flawed selection process, and the team’s struggles with underperforming players.
He also addresses Babar Azam’s declining form, the lack of match-winners, and the culture of favoritism affecting team performance. Atiq highlights the poor state of domestic cricket, the failure of Pakistan’s power-hitting camp, and the selfish mindset of players. He believes a complete overhaul is needed, from coaching to player development.
Main topics covered in this interview:
Rizwan’s Captaincy Scrutiny: Assessing Mohammad Rizwan’s leadership and tactical decisions in the series against New Zealand.
Turmoil in Pakistan’s Camp: Behind-the-scenes tensions and internal conflicts affecting team morale and performance.
Players’ Discontent Over Gillespie’s Removal: Examining the reaction of players to Jason Gillespie’s sudden departure and its impact on the team.
Faheem Ashraf’s Selection: Questions arise over whether Faheem Ashraf’s inclusion in the squad was based on merit or external pressure.
Poor Crowd Turnout at Karachi Stadium: Exploring the reasons behind the empty stands and the declining enthusiasm for home matches.
Fans Losing Interest in Pakistan Cricket: A deep dive into why Pakistani cricket fans are becoming increasingly disillusioned with the team.
India vs Pakistan: Reviewing the much-anticipated showdown between arch-rivals India and Pakistan in the Champions Trophy.
